Intarsia I - Bill Boggs We will be learning to cut and shape small pieces of colorful or otherwise interesting rocks and actually gluing them together to form intricate scenic and/or geometric patterns. This is a basic class. We will be using flat laps and Intarsia grinders (not faceting machines). Materials are provided but feel free to bring some of your own if you like. A start-up kit of basic supplies will be provided for a nominal cost. The overall costs for the week will depend upon how many slabs and of which type of material you purchase. Overall costs for the week will be less if you have your own material.

Intarsia II - Bill Boggs We will be building on skills learned in Intarsia 1 to create more diverse and complex designs. Examples include quilt square patterns, open-space designs, wing patterns, stone-in-stone dots, and simple curve fitting. Additionally, we will explore problem solving techniques for working with certain difficult materials and/or situations. We will be using flat laps and intarsia grinders (not faceting machines). A selection of materials will be available, but you are encouraged to bring some of your own. A start-up kit of basic supplies will be provided for a nominal cost. The overall costs for the week will depend upon the amounts and types of material you purchase. Overall costs for the week will be less if you have your own material.
